Understanding the Importance of HMRC Compliance
The Role of HMRC
HMRC is the UK government department responsible for the collection of taxes, payment of some forms of state support, and administration of other regulatory regimes. Its primary aim is to ensure that the UKโs tax system operates fairly and efficiently. Compliance with HMRC regulations is not only a legal obligation but also essential for maintaining a good standing with the tax authority and avoiding potential penalties.

The Risks of Non-Compliance
Failing to stay compliant with HMRC updates can lead to severe consequences, including:
- Financial Penalties: Late payments or incorrect filings can result in fines and interest charges.
- Legal Action: Continued non-compliance can lead to legal proceedings, which can be costly and time-consuming.
- Reputational Damage: Businesses may suffer from reputational harm, affecting relationships with customers, suppliers, and other stakeholders.
